EIP 4337 فعال شده توسط اتریوم (ETH): راهنمای جامع


تصویر مقاله

ولادیسلاو سوپوف

این است که چرا «Account Abstraction» تغییر دهنده بازی برای اتریوم (ETH) در سال 2023 است – و فرصت‌هایی را که برای کاربران و توسعه‌دهندگان باز می‌کند

با فعال‌سازی عملکرد جدید، هر صاحب کیف پول اتریوم غیرحضوری (ETH) می‌تواند عملکرد آن را به طور چشمگیری افزایش دهد و تجربه خود را با اتریوم (ETH) و بلاک چین‌های سازگار با EVM ایمن کند.

EIP 4337 روی اتریوم (ETH) به صورت زنده اجرا می شود: نکات برجسته

دیروز، در 1 مارس 2023، توسعه دهندگان اتریوم (ETH) اعلام کردند که مکانیسم انتزاع حساب موجود در پیشنهاد بهبود اتریوم (EIP 4337) تست استرس، ممیزی شده و در شبکه اصلی مستقر شده است.

  • از سال 2016 در حال بحث است، Account Abstraction یکی از جاه طلبانه ترین تغییرات طراحی اتریوم (ETH) است.
  • EIP 4337 توسط بنیاد اتریوم و تعدادی از تیم های قدرتمند Web3 توسعه داده شده است: Stackup، Biconomy، Alchemy. OpenZeppelin ممیزی امنیتی خود را انجام داد.
  • این مرز بین حساب های دارای مالکیت خارجی (کیف پول) و حساب های قراردادی (قراردادهای هوشمند) را محو می کند و ابزار جدیدی را در اتریوم معرفی می کند: حساب های هوشمند.
  • این به روز رسانی برای امنیت، عملکرد و پذیرش گسترده بلاک چین اتریوم (ETH) از اهمیت بالایی برخوردار است.
  • علاوه بر اتریوم (ETH)، این به‌روزرسانی در تمام بلاک‌چین‌های سازگار با EVM اجرا می‌شود: شبکه Polygon (MATIC)، زنجیره BNB (BSC)، شبکه‌های L2 اتریوم و غیره.

با فعال‌سازی EIP 4337، کاربران اتریوم (ETH) می‌توانند کیف پول‌های غیرقانونی خود را به بانک‌های غیرمتمرکز تمام پشته تبدیل کنند. این از کاربران جدید در برابر از دست دادن دسترسی به کیف پول ETH خود به دلیل مشکلات عبارت seed محافظت می کند.

EIP چیست؟

پیشنهادهای بهبود اتریوم (EIPs) توضیحاتی برای استانداردهای شبکه اتریوم (ETH) هستند: مشخصات پروتکل اصلی، APIهای مشتری و استانداردهای قرارداد. به روز رسانی های عمده شبکه با اجرای شبکه اصلی این یا آن EIP همراه است.

علاقه مندان به اتریوم (ETH) پیشنهادات خود را برای بحث و بررسی ارسال می کنند. چرخه کامل تایید هشت مرحله طول می کشد. برخی از EIP های پیچیده باعث بحث های داغ شد و سال ها مورد بحث قرار گرفت.

EIP 20 (معرفی توکن های ERC-20 در اتریوم)، EIP 721 (استاندارد توکن غیرقابل تعویض) و EIP 1559 (مدل کارمزد تراکنش پویا با رویدادهای سوزاندن توکن دوره ای) از مهم ترین EIP ها از زمان پیدایش اتریوم (ETH) هستند.

EOA و CA در اتریوم چیست؟

اتریوم، اولین شبکه بلاک چین با پشتیبانی از قراردادهای هوشمند (بلاک چین قابل برنامه ریزی)، دو نوع حساب در طراحی خود دارد. به عبارت ساده، نه بر خلاف برنامه های بانکداری و پرداخت سنتی، یک حساب اتریوم (ETH) جایی است که ارز دیجیتال ذخیره می شود.

حساب‌های تحت مالکیت خارجی (یا EOA) می‌توانند ارزهای دیجیتال را ذخیره کنند، اما خودشان قادر به ارسال تراکنش‌ها نیستند. کاربران باید تراکنش ها را با کلیدهای خصوصی مجاز کنند. کیف پول‌های کریپتو مانند MetaMask نمونه‌های کتاب درسی EOA هستند.

در مقابل، حساب های قراردادی برنامه های نرم افزاری هستند که می توانند عملیات مالی را انجام دهند. آنها توسط کد کنترل می شوند، نه کلیدهای خصوصی. قراردادهای هوشمند - عناصر اصلی پروتکل‌های DeFi و NFT - از نظر طراحی «حساب‌های قرارداد» (CAs) هستند.

EIP 4337 یا Account Abstraction (AA) چیست؟

EIP 4337 ارتقاء طراحی شبکه اتریوم (ETH) است. این به عنوان یک لایه اضافی در بالای شبکه اصلی اتریوم (ETH) پیاده سازی شده است، بنابراین برای فعال شدن نیازی به هارد فورک ندارد. با استفاده از Account Abstraction، کاربران اتریوم (ETH) می توانند به راحتی کیف پول خود را به یک قرارداد هوشمند تبدیل کرده و آنها را با قابلیت های اضافی شارژ کنند.

"حساب هوشمند" نوع جدیدی از کیف پول است که با EIP 4337 در دسترس قرار می گیرد. اول از همه، کاربران عادی می توانند حساب های خود را به فضای ذخیره سازی چند امضایی تبدیل کنند. با این کار نیازی به مسئولیت مالکان حساب در قبال کلیدهای خصوصی نیست.

eip4337
تصویر جمع کردن

بنیاد اتریوم تاکید می‌کند که EIP 4337 امکان استفاده از نتایج محاسبات خارج از زنجیره را در زنجیره فراهم می‌کند، که واقعاً بازی را برای ساخت اتریوم (ETH) با ویژگی‌های غنی تغییر می‌دهد:

ERC-4337 تلاش می کند همان کاری را انجام دهد که EIP-2938 انجام می دهد، اما از طریق ابزارهای فراپروتکلی. انتظار می رود که کاربران پیام های خارج از زنجیره ای به نام عملیات کاربر ارسال کنند، که به صورت انبوه در یک تراکنش منفرد توسط پیشنهاد دهنده بلوک یا سازنده که بسته هایی را برای پیشنهاد دهندگان بلوک تولید می کند، جمع آوری و بسته بندی می شود. پیشنهاد دهنده یا سازنده مسئول فیلتر کردن عملیات است تا اطمینان حاصل شود که آنها فقط عملیاتی را می پذیرند که هزینه پرداخت می کنند. یک حافظه جداگانه برای عملیات کاربر وجود دارد، و گره‌های متصل به این ممپول، اعتبارسنجی‌های ویژه ERC-4337 را انجام می‌دهند تا اطمینان حاصل شود که عملیات کاربر قبل از ارسال آن، هزینه پرداخت می‌کند.

از اولین روزهای عملیات EIP 4337 - به عنوان نشان داد توسط جان رایزینگ، یکی از بنیانگذاران Stackup و حامی ارتقاء صوتی - عملکرد جدید دارای یک پس‌زمینه زیرساختی قوی است و در تمام بلاک‌چین‌های اصلی سازگار با EVM در دسترس است.

چگونه EIP 4337 اتریوم (ETH) را برای همیشه تغییر خواهد داد

EIP 4337 قبلاً در رتبه‌بندی مهم‌ترین و جاه‌طلبانه‌ترین EIP در تاریخ اتریوم (ETH) قرار گرفته است. با فعال شدن EIP 4337، تجربه اتریوم (ETH) برای نسل جدیدی از کاربران و توسعه دهندگان متفاوت خواهد بود.

EIP 4337 برای امنیت

وقتی صحبت از مدیریت کلید خصوصی می شود، EIP 4337 این امکان را برای کاربران مختلف فراهم می کند تا تراکنش ها را از یک حساب مجاز کنند. به این ترتیب، دارندگان اتریوم (ETH) می‌توانند کیف پول خود را با گوشی هوشمند ادغام کنند تا مدیریت کلید را ساده‌تر کرده و ابزار بازیابی اضافی برای سکه‌های خود اضافه کنند.

EIP 4337 برای قابلیت استفاده

وقتی صحبت از قراردادهای هوشمند به میان می‌آید، EIP 4337 راه را برای قراردادهای 100% «بدون گاز» هموار می‌کند: اکنون توسعه‌دهندگان می‌توانند فرصت استفاده از این یا آن کیف پول را به‌عنوان منبعی برای پرداخت‌های گاز به‌صورت سخت کدنویسی کنند. پیش از این، چنین طرحی نیاز داشت که همه تراکنش‌ها با کلیدهای خصوصی مجاز شوند.

EIP 4337 برای پذیرش گسترده

همه علاقه مندان، حامیان و توسعه دهندگان EIP 4337 مطمئن هستند که تجربه کاربری اتریوم (ETH) را برای افراد تازه کار راحت تر خواهد کرد. جعبه ابزار اتریوم (ETH) بیش از هر زمان دیگری دارای ویژگی های غنی شده است. اکنون طراحی‌های پیچیده‌تر و عجیب‌تری را امکان‌پذیر می‌کند که بدون «حساب‌های هوشمند» غیرممکن بود.

جمع بندی: بعدی برای انتزاع حساب در EVM چیست؟

به این ترتیب، فعال‌سازی EIP 4337 نقطه عطف مهمی برای اتریوم (ETH) در سال 2023 است. در حالی که اکنون تحت الشعاع ارتقای مورد انتظار شانگهای (و وعده‌های اقتصادی آن) قرار گرفته است، انتزاع حساب برای ابزار اتریوم (ETH) به اندازه EIP مهم است. 721 و EIP 1155.

در همین حال، این داستان به پایان نرسیده است: در ویتالیک بوترین نقشه راه اهداف بلند مدت برای انتزاع حساب هستند. تبدیل اجباری به حساب‌های سازگار با EIP 4337 و روش‌های مقاوم در برابر سانسور گام‌های بعدی در توسعه AA برای اتریوم خواهد بود.

منبع: https://u.today/eip-4337-activated-by-ethereum-eth-comprehensive-guide